Output db6a319491522176492a1750493f80cb426605ad066893c696e06f6139e08e73:0

value
115000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f4eb1b65af9f5eaeff42b2869a2364d590785d OP_EQUAL
address
3MekdbD94dx7Xpk7qQAPtTbhK74ptmw6Vb
transaction
db6a319491522176492a1750493f80cb426605ad066893c696e06f6139e08e73
spent
true